#f64f3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f64f3e is composed of 96.5% red, 31%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#f64f3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e7c with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f64f3e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f64f3e has RGB values of R:246, G:79,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.75,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16142142.

Hex triplet f64f3e #f64f3e
RGB Decimal 246, 79, 62 rgb(246,79,62)
RGB Percent 96.5, 31, 24.3 rgb(96.5%,31%,24.3%)
CMYK 0, 68, 75, 4
HSL 5.5°, 91.1, 60.4 hsl(5.5,91.1%,60.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 5.5°, 74.8, 96.5
Web Safe ff6633 #ff6633
CIE-LAB 57.595, 62.627, 45.669
XYZ 41.673, 25.537, 7.292
xyY 0.559, 0.343, 25.537
CIE-LCH 57.595, 77.51, 36.1
CIE-LUV 57.595, 131.33, 34.657
Hunter-Lab 50.535, 58.765, 26.819
Binary 11110110, 01001111, 00111110

Shades and Tints of #f64f3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0201 is the darkest color, while #fffaf9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f64f3e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7f7f7f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#977572 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#9d9058 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b2893b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f75559 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bd784f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#ca743c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f6534f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
